
Gianluca Buffon
Gianluca Buffon is a legendary Italian goalkeeper, widely regarded as one of the greatest goalkeepers of all time. Born on January 28, 1978, in Carrara, Italy, Buffon began his professional career with Parma, where he achieved significant success, including winning the Serie A title and the UEFA Cup. He is best known for his long and storied career with Juventus, where he won multiple league titles and established himself as a formidable presence in goal. Buffon was also a key player for the Italian national team, famously leading them to victory in the 2006 FIFA World Cup. Known for his leadership, shot-stopping ability, and longevity in the sport, Buffon's influence extends beyond the pitch, making him an iconic figure in football history.
